    Is there a difference between a rebuilt and re-manufactured 42RLE?

    @AMS417 thank you. @lafittejeep Are there any codes present? Limp mode usually brings a 0700 and an underlying code. Check the black connector on your Jeep as that controls the shifting. Spray some contact cleaner and make sure the red clips are firmly clipped in. I have enclosed a few photos...

  8. Wranglerfix

    97 TJ immobilizer problem solved

    If the vehicle starts with a screwdriver it isn’t the immobilizer causing the issue. Have you checked powers, grounds, wiring and starter?
